Gena Rowlands: Emmy and Golden Globe winner, “A Woman Under the Influence,” Badass, 1930-2024
Gena Rowlands had a late life blockbuster, “The Notebook,” which made for a fine curtain call on a career that spanned half a century. She played the older version of Rachel McAdams in a teary eyed romance about a devoted … Continue reading

Movie Review: A brilliant mind, a son’s love tested to their limits — “Rob Peace”
Chiwetel Ejiofor‘s “Rob Peace” surfs the ebb and flow of one life in making an age-old point about race and life in America. Simply put, it underscores the message of generations of TV ads for The United Negro College Fund … Continue reading

Movie Review: Kit Harington fights “The Beast Within”
“The Beast Within” is a stylish, allegorical werewolf thriller that toys with its mysteries but can never escape the absurdity that clumsy plotting built into it. Alexander J. Farrell’s British woodslands tale is seen through the eyes of a child. … Continue reading
